[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 112: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 112: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 112: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 112: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 112: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 112: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 112: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/functions.php on line 4688: Cannot modify header information - headers already sent by (output started at [ROOT]/includes/functions.php:3823)
[phpBB Debug] PHP Warning: in file [ROOT]/includes/functions.php on line 4690: Cannot modify header information - headers already sent by (output started at [ROOT]/includes/functions.php:3823)
[phpBB Debug] PHP Warning: in file [ROOT]/includes/functions.php on line 4691: Cannot modify header information - headers already sent by (output started at [ROOT]/includes/functions.php:3823)
[phpBB Debug] PHP Warning: in file [ROOT]/includes/functions.php on line 4692: Cannot modify header information - headers already sent by (output started at [ROOT]/includes/functions.php:3823)
Parallella Community • View topic - USB Issue Troubleshooting
Page 8 of 11

Re: USB Issue Troubleshooting

PostPosted: Mon Jun 22, 2015 3:03 pm
by ArunD

Re: USB Issue Troubleshooting

PostPosted: Mon Jun 22, 2015 4:21 pm
by xilman

Re: USB Issue Troubleshooting

PostPosted: Mon Jun 22, 2015 4:48 pm
by tnt
I'm not exactly sure what people are still discussing here ...

AFAICT from the history of this thread, the issue has been diagnosed. The ULPI PHY sometimes comes out of reset in a weird state where it's not responsive despite being provided with a clean reset pulse. The design used the Xilinx recommended PHY and is connected properly so it _should_ work. Obviously it doesn't (or not reliably for some people) so the failure lies either with Xilinx's zynq doing weird stuff on the pin pre-boot or with the PHY behaving strangely sometimes, but at this point it really doesn't matter all that much.

Given that none of this is under software control, I don't see how a firmware upgrade or FPGA bitstream upgrade alone would do anything. The only solution seems to be to extend the reset pulse of the PHY about 100ms longer than the one from the PS (so that the FSBL has had time to properly configure the pins) and this will require some hw mod. The question is how to achieve that in the easiest way possible.

Re: USB Issue Troubleshooting

PostPosted: Tue Jun 23, 2015 2:24 pm
by ajtravis

Re: USB Issue Troubleshooting

PostPosted: Tue Jun 23, 2015 2:50 pm
by ajtravis

Re: USB Issue Troubleshooting

PostPosted: Tue Jun 23, 2015 3:12 pm
by tnt
AFAIK you can use the porcupine to connect two boards together via the elinks ? There are 2 connectors for each PEC that can be used with standard 2mm pitch IDC cables.

Re: USB Issue Troubleshooting

PostPosted: Tue Jun 23, 2015 3:21 pm
by ajtravis

Re: USB Issue Troubleshooting

PostPosted: Tue Jun 23, 2015 3:37 pm
by tnt

Re: USB Issue Troubleshooting

PostPosted: Tue Jun 23, 2015 4:03 pm
by ajtravis

Re: USB Issue Troubleshooting

PostPosted: Sun Jun 28, 2015 12:44 am
by njpacoma
Adding myself to the list of people having problems.

* Failure mode (sometimes or always?)
99% failure (I have gotten USB to work once with the headless and once with the HDMI configurations.)

* Headless/hdmi configuration
Both.

* FPGA/Linux/Ubuntu version being used
headless: Linux parallella 3.14.12-parallella-xilinx-g40a90c3 #1 SMP PREEMPT Fri Jan 23 22:01:51 CET 2015 armv7l armv7l armv7l GNU/Linux

* Fan used?
Yes.

* SKU#
P1601-DK03, SN 0010680

* Power supply used
Supplied with kit ordered from Amazon.

I have had my Parallella for less than 1 week. I have had the USB problem since day 1. I have tried many different setups and workarounds from the comments in this thread. While I am sufficiently interested in this system to use it headless, I am disappointed that this problem still exists without a real solution. A problem of this significance could really impact the acceptance and adoption of this very interesting and useful product.